Common procurement and integration challenges

  • Misaligned pricing models can inflate per-user costs when CRM seats and eSignature seats are purchased separately, complicating budgeting for distributed teams.
  • Integration complexity between an eSignature provider and a CRM increases implementation time and may require API work or middleware for reliable data sync.
  • Compliance differences—HIPAA, FERPA, ESIGN/UETA—require careful feature verification and possible add-on contracts to meet sector-specific obligations.
  • Feature overlap and duplicate functionality across CRM and eSignature platforms can lead to redundant subscriptions and underused capabilities.

Integration and template features that matter

Key integration and template capabilities determine how easily eSignature fits into CRM-driven sales, HR, or compliance processes and influence overall cost of ownership.

Native CRM connector

A built-in connector reduces setup time and maintenance overhead by enabling one-click sends from CRM records, two-way status updates, and automatic attachment of signed documents to the corresponding contact or deal.

Role-based templates

Preconfigured templates with role assignments streamline repeated documents like NDAs or offer letters, lowering per-transaction time and reducing the risk of missing required fields during signing sessions.

Bulk Send

Capability to send a single document to many recipients at scale supports high-volume outreach, keeps per-signature costs predictable, and expedites mass contract collections without manual individual sends.

Conditional fields

Smart fields that show or hide based on input reduce signer confusion, minimize corrections, and reduce rework and associated labor costs when collecting varied contract data.

Practical best practices when choosing and configuring tools

Follow these recommendations to optimize costs, ensure compliance, and maintain efficient document workflows when comparing signNow and Zoho CRM for business use.

Verify regulatory requirements before purchase
Confirm HIPAA, FERPA, or industry-specific requirements early to determine whether base plans suffice or whether add-on agreements and configurations are required for legal compliance.
Consolidate users to limit redundant licenses
Audit active users and roles; assign eSignature seats only to those who send or manage documents to avoid unnecessary per-user subscription costs.
Standardize templates and approval routing
Create centralized document templates and automated approval chains to reduce signer errors, speed up execution, and lower administrative time spent on manual reviews.
Monitor usage and renegotiate periodically
Track document volume and API calls to align plans with actual demand and revisit vendor pricing or volume discounts at renewal for potential savings.
